Output 9e740e02ae2bed265ed76728cdbad79e6efec508302f5abe7c0ad53e5a662b9a:0

value
665722
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12921bdc332589f108a621268223a38a3c7af30a OP_EQUAL
address
33PD7pHbbACUjoDZ1FaAJAsRTq5dgu1L7H
transaction
9e740e02ae2bed265ed76728cdbad79e6efec508302f5abe7c0ad53e5a662b9a
spent
true